Post-Reading
As I thought…
Chrysantha is a whole delight—she’s all calculated charm and “silly girl” theatrics hiding an absolutely steel spine. I loved watching her plot her way through increasingly complex social knots, all while making sure she looked fabulous doing it. This is fun, twisty fantasy with a deliciously vain, smart heroine who will absolutely kill you with a smile.
It surprised me by…
Leaning even harder into female rage and the cost of being underestimated. Yes, it’s full of glitz and flirtation, but there’s something quietly satisfying in watching a woman weaponize the way the world sees her. Chrysantha knows she’s being judged—and uses it like a blade.
